Evaluation of Dopaminergic Denervation by DaTSCAN Brain Scintigraphy Using a New Multipurpose CZT System (STARDAT)
Clinical Evaluation of a New Multipurpose Whole-body CZT Camera in DaTSCAN Brain Scintigraphy: a Head-to-head Comparison With a Conventional System.
Sponsor: Centre Hospitalier Régional d'Orléans
Terminated
As the team at Nancy University Hospital published the same study last year, on the competing CZT 3D system (Veriton), our study is no longer relevant.
